Read MoreParkinson’s disease, a progressive neurodegenerative disorder, has been a significant concern for the global medical community, and India is no exception. With an estimated 7,71,000 Parkinson’s patients in India as of 2019, the need for effective treatment for Parkinson's has never been more pressing. Recent developments in the field of neuroscience have brought new hope to patients and their families, as innovative approaches to managing and potentially treating this complex condition emerge.
Parkinson’s disease is characterized by a range of motor and non-motor symptoms, including tremors, stiffness, slow movement, and balance problems. In India, the prevalence of Parkinson’s is estimated to range from 15 to 43 per 100,000 population, positioning the country to potentially have one of the highest absolute numbers of PD patients globally.
What’s particularly concerning is the trend of early-onset Parkinson’s in India. Nearly 40-45% of Indian patients experience the early onset of motor symptoms between the ages of 22 and 49. This early onset not only affects the quality of life of younger individuals but also poses significant socio-economic challenges.
In a groundbreaking development, Indian scientists have unveiled a nanoformulation designed to enhance the safety and effectiveness of Parkinson’s disease treatment. This targeted drug delivery system enables the sustained release of 17β-oestradiol (E2), a hormone essential for managing Parkinson’s symptoms.
The innovative approach utilizes dopamine receptor D3 (DRD3)-conjugated chitosan nanoparticles to precisely deliver 17β-oestradiol to the brain. This method significantly improves the hormone’s therapeutic potential while potentially reducing side effects.
Another promising avenue of research comes from the Institute of Nano Science and Technology (INST) Mohali. Scientists there have demonstrated that a nano-formulation of melatonin could provide a therapeutic solution for Parkinson’s disease.
Melatonin, typically known for its role in regulating sleep patterns, has shown potential in enhancing mitophagy a quality control mechanism that removes dysfunctional mitochondria and reduces oxidative stress. The nano-formulation of melatonin resulted in sustained release and improved bioavailability, enhancing its antioxidative and neuroprotective properties.
While these breakthrough treatments offer hope, it’s crucial to remember that managing Parkinson’s disease requires a comprehensive, multidisciplinary approach. This is where rehabilitation plays a vital role.
Contrary to the common misconception that rehabilitation is only necessary in the later stages of Parkinson’s, experts now emphasize the importance of starting rehabilitative care early. Rehabilitation can play a crucial role in managing and improving PD symptoms, function, and quality of life from day one.

Specialized Parkinson’s care centers are becoming increasingly important in India. These centers offer a range of services, from diagnosis and medical management to rehabilitation and psychological support. They often employ a team of specialists, including neurologists, physiotherapists, occupational therapists, speech therapists, and mental health professionals, to provide holistic care to patients.
